NVIDIA is seeking a Senior Network Deployment Engineer to help build and scale our global network. In this role, you'll be responsible for sourcing, procuring and delivering infrastructure and circuits to support Point-of-Presence (PoP) deployments. This role manages vendor relationships, contract negotiations, procurement, and project execution to ensure PoP sites are delivered on-time and meet network capacity, resilience and operational requirements.
What you'll be doing:- Manage end-to-end provisioning of network services (wavelengths, Ethernet, IP transit, dark fiber & subsea IRU).
- Partner with carriers and data centers to track orders, delivery, and handoff.
- Document LOAs, CFAs, and circuit details in inventory and ticketing systems. Support circuit testing/troubleshooting during turn-up.
- Source and procure POP space, power, cross-connects and related services.
- Lead vendor selection, contract negotiations, and SLA management. Coordinate PoP handover schedules with the network deployment and engineering teams, legal and procurement.
- Manage site readiness schedules, equipment logistics and service requests. Plan for power capacity, rack utilization and future growth potential.
- Monitor vendor performance, operational costs and contract compliance. Maintain documentation for contracts, power allocations and deployment standards.
- Support PoP expansions, upgrades and decommissioning activities. Keep projects on track in a fast-moving, deadline-driven environment.
What we need to see:- Bachelor's degree in network engineering, telecommunications, or a related field, or equivalent experience.
- 8+ years of relevant work experience
- Knowledge of transport technologies (DWDM, Ethernet, OTN, MPLS) Technical knowledge of datacenter rack and power infrastructure and equipment
- Familiarity with LOA/CFA, cross-connects, and datacenter environments
- Ability to translate engineering requirements into requests for proposal (RFPs) and carrier service orders.
- Experience in researching, negotiating and leasing space/power for PoPs
- Expertise in the end-to-end procurement of subsea, spectrum, and IRU assets Expertise in executing global sourcing initiatives across multiple international markets
- Detail oriented with an attested ability to multitask in a dynamic environment with shifting priorities and changing requirements
- Strength working independently and actively with minimal direction
Ways to stand out from the crowd:- PM Certification/training a strong plus
- Experience with multi-cloud networking (AWS VPC, Azure VNet, GCP VPC)
- Excellent architecture documentation and interpersonal skills. Ability to lead cross-functional technical initiatives.
